Fairness has an important place in the practice of accounting. It is stated in the auditor's report that the financial statements present fairly the results of operations and cash flows for the year ended in conformity with generally accepted accounting principles. The statement presents to the users and the market the guarantee that the accountants (as preparers) and the auditors (as attestors) have strived to be fair. This conventional nature of the concept of fairness is fairness in presentation, connoting an idea of neutrality in the preparation and presentation of financial reports and the idea of justice in outcome. This view of fairness in accounting as fairness in presentation is rather limited calling for expansion of the notion of fairness to deal with distribution, disclosure and resource allocation considerations. Accordingly, the main objective of this book is to explain the conventional notion of fairness in presentation before elaborating on the more interesting notions of fairness in distribution, fairness in disclosure and fairness in resource allocation.
